: Benzo-alpha-pyrene (BAP), a cancer-causing pollutant is released by the burning of coal. It is ten times more in an urban area than in the rural area. In some areas the effect of this air pollutant on people who do not smoke cigarettes may go up to:
A.An effect equal to that of those who smoke two packets of cigarettes without filters
B.An effect less than that of those who smoke
C. An equivalent effect of one-tenth of those who smoke
D. An effect equal to that of those who smoke two cigarettes a day

Hint:BAP is a carcinogen and hence its effect is going to be massive on the lung structures. The carcinogen expression differs in different areas according to the number of industries and their emissions and so judge according to pollution index.
Complete answer:
Benzo-alpha-pyrene (BAP) is a specific mutagen that results in mutations in the lungs causing lung cancer. These pollutants are air-borne and these are produced due to the burning of coal in the different areas. There are two specific regions where these pollutants are found, which include the urban and rural areas. The urban areas have a higher level of industries and hence the emission of BAP is also higher as compared to that of the rural areas.
This air pollutant is one of the major causes of lung cancer and can be compared to smoking about two packets of cigarettes without any filter. The changes that occur due to this pollutant is as high as that of smoking so many cigarettes. This means that the air pollutant has an optimum effect on the lungs the same as that of so many cigarettes.
The internal lung tissues can be damaged due to BAP and the changes in the genetic character due to carcinogen leads to lung cancer. People living in these areas are expected to face challenges with BAP and most of the people are prone to have their lungs damaged due to the effects on the lung tissue. Therefore, the answer to the question is A. An effect equal to that of those who smoke two packets of cigarettes without filters.
Note:
Lung cancer is a major problem in urban cities as compared to that of the rural areas. The rural areas have less chance of pollution which can reduce the chance of people suffering from lung diseases.
